Traders Atlanta - Hours & Locations

1

Traders - Atlanta

485 Flat Shoals Av Se, Atlanta GA 30316 Phone Number:(404) 522-3006
  1. Store Hours

Hours may fluctuate

Distance:3.12 miles
Edit